The Global Coalition to Bring Jiang to Justice Announces Its Establishment in Washington DC (photo)
(Clearwisdom.net) Epochtimes news net reports that The Global Coalition to Bring
Jiang Zemin to Justice formally announced its establishment in the National Press Club in
Washington DC on the morning of September 30, 2003. The Coalition is committed to embodying all
righteous forces and exposing all the crimes of Jiang Zemin. The Coalition will ensure that Jiang is
brought to justice in the court of conscience, the court of morality and the court of law. To date,
over 100 organizations and individuals have joined in to support the Coalition. The Coalition press conference Li Dayong, one of the initiators of the Coalition, said in the founding announcement, "Since
Jiang Zemin became Secretary General of the Communist Party, there have been complete setbacks in
the Chinese society and social morality." "His crimes in China have threatened the very
basic values upon which civilization is based. Almost all individuals and large groups wishing to
express independent beliefs, mindsets, different ways of thinking or demands, including the students
who appealed for democracy on June 4, 1989, laid-off workers, religious believers, qigong
practitioners, human rights and democracy advocates, journalists and media workers, and political
activists have all suffered persecution to various degrees. In particular, hundreds of millions of
Falun Gong practitioners who believe in the principle of í Truthfulness-Compassion-Tolerance' have
suffered brutal persecution which is aimed to í defame their reputation, bankrupt them financially,
and destroy them physically.'" Li Dayong said that such atrocities are still happening. They have been working very hard by
peacefully calling for an end to Jiang's crimes. However, "the existing National People's
Congress, legal system, and the police system in China do not have the ability, means and courage to
investigate and stop Jiang's crimes and uphold justice." As to governments or organizations
outside of China, "because of people's lack of understanding about Jiang's crimes," or
"due to the financial and political pressure," there have certainly been obstacles.

rights to even defend themselves have been forcefully taken away. Dr. He Haiying, one of the contact persons for the Preparation Committee of the Coalition,
pointed out, "After the Second World War, a new crime was introduced based upon the violent
massacres induced by the Nazis, and this was called í genocide.' The crimes that Jiang has
committed however, go not only as far as physically destroying religious organizations and
individuals but he's also demolishing people's basic morals and human consciousness. This new crime
that Jiang has committed can be referred to as í Morality Genocide.'" Falun Gong representative Chen Gang also commented by describing how he was detained in a labor
camp for 18 months because of his belief in Truthfulness- Compassion-Forbearance. In these 18
months, among the various physical and mental tortures, he was forcefully kept awake for fifteen
consecutive days and was shocked in sensitive parts and areas of his body with high voltage electric
batons. At one time, he had his head tied to his legs and was shoved under a low bed with a heavy
object resting on top. This incident almost resulted in the breaking of his spinal cord and caused
him to not be able to walk normally for two weeks. Mr. Chen's portrayal of his horrific experience
further reflected the degree of persecution and the atrocities that Jiang Zemin has directed upon
